The 'Steal My Girl' hitmakers are preparing to embark on a two-year hiatus and found it "bromantic" bonding together as they said goodbye to their fans at their 'On the Road Again' shows.

Liam Payne said: "We did get very emotional, obviously a lot of the songs that will be the last time we'll sing them for awhile.

"It was a great night with the fans, it was bromatic."

The quartet's new album is called 'Made in the AM', which Liam explained is due to their preference for working "very late at night".

Speaking on 'Good Morning America', he said: "We make a lot of our music very late at night, never very early, we're lazy people."

During their appearance on the show, the band performed new track 'Love You Goodbye', with Louis Tomlinson - who wrote the track - admitting it had a cheeky meaning.

He said: "It's kind of about you know when you get to the end of a relationship and you want to meet up one last time, you know what I'm saying."

Harry Styles explained the rest of the group - which also includes Niall Horan - don't have too much input into a track once it has been written by one of their bandmates.

He said: "I think sometimes when someone's written a personal song, you kind of want to leave that alone, you don't want to change it too much."
